Egypt: Explosive Materials On MS804 Passengers

Credit: Tobias Litek
WASHINGTON—The Egyptian civil aviation ministry said “traces of explosive materials” were found in the bodies of some of the passengers on EgyptAir Flight 804, the Airbus A320 that crashed into the Mediterranean Sea north of Egypt early on the morning of May 19 on a flight from Paris to Cairo...
